통신 클래스 인터페이스는 USB 인터페이스 설명자, 세 개의 클래스별 설명자 및 알림 엔드포인트에 대한 엔드포인트 설명자로 설명됩니다. The notification endpoint descriptor is a standard USB Interrupt-type IN endpoint descriptor whose wMaxPacketSize field is 8 bytes. 다음 표에서는 Communication Class 인터페이스 설명자의 눈에 띄는 필드를 정의합니다.
| Offset (bytes) | Field | Size (bytes) | Value | Description |
|---|---|---|---|---|
5 |
bInterfaceClass |
1 |
02h |
통신 인터페이스 클래스 코드입니다. |
6 |
bInterfaceSubClass |
1 |
02h |
추상 제어 모델에 대한 통신 인터페이스 클래스 하위 클래스 코드입니다. |
7 |
bInterfaceProtocol |
1 |
FFh |
공급업체별 프로토콜에 대한 통신 인터페이스 클래스 프로토콜 코드입니다. |